There are so many factors, cold spot, hot spot, spot up vs moving/shooting off the dribble, ratings and streaks as well as fatigue. Shoot Kerr and Kellog give you clues when you are gunning and taking bad shots.
I think it should work like this like pieces of a pie. The shot quality should be tied to the ratings and tendency of the player and then relate back to how you perform how to what your ratings and tendencies. Call this 40% of the pie. Then there should be a second portion of it tied to the release timing and a certain portion tied to fatigue and and certain portion tied to cold or hot streak, then a certain portion tied to zones of the court.
So if you are a league average shooter from certain spots when open then you should not receive better than a C shot quality even with perfect release. If you are Steph Curry/ and can shoot off the dribble with heavy iso moves with no problem then your shot quality can be B+ or better.
So just relate the shot quality in reference to league numbers and then we will see way more C's than B+'s and A'sComment
